In the year-to-date period, PTF achieves a 69.64% return, which is significantly higher than MGK's 5.33% return. Over the past 10 years, PTF has outperformed MGK with an annualized return of 26.39%, while MGK has yielded a comparatively lower 18.85% annualized return.

The correlation between PTF and MGK is 0.67,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

The maximum PTF drawdown since its inception was -55.38%, which is greater than MGK's maximum drawdown of -48.43%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for PTF and MGK.

PTF vs. MGK - Expense Ratio Comparison

PTF has a 0.60% expense ratio, which is higher than MGK's 0.05% expense ratio.

PTF is categorized as Momentum, while MGK is Large Cap Growth Equities. PTF tracks DWA Technology Technical Leaders Index, while MGK tracks CRSP US Mega Cap Growth Index. They also come from different issuers: Invesco and Vanguard. Their fees differ too: 0.60% for PTF and 0.05% for MGK.
